The size of Leanyer is approximately 5.9 square kilometres. It has 14 parks covering nearly 59.3% of total area. The population of Leanyer in 2016 was 4578 people. By 2021 the population was 4597 showing a population growth of 0.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Leanyer is 30-39 years. Households in Leanyer are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Leanyer work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 64.90% of the homes in Leanyer were owner-occupied compared with 60.30% in 2016.
